Reading this because I had a problem where I created a ringtone in itunes and changed it to m4r and didn't work on a number of occasions but if you follow this step it should work because this step worked for me: Open itunes, find the song you want - change the play length 30Secs or less, options or advanced - create ACC version, drag it to your desk top, go back to itunes delete the ACC version, back to desk top and drag the song into itunes library now you should see in the ringtone section and now it should snyc

like they said, you need to right click. get info. set the start stop time to 0:00:00 0:30:00

then create AAC.

then go into your music folder. rename the file to .m4r and then double click it. it then auto adds it to your Ringtones folder and then you can sync it.

the file must be 30 seconds or less.
